Transaction 708846e3b998624690dd9c4e7cf1b1beca1e1517e7f7b8c54285d5417095d7e4

3 Input
1 Outputs
  • 708846e3b998624690dd9c4e7cf1b1beca1e1517e7f7b8c54285d5417095d7e4:0
  • value  216427
    address  13DfVMYqa6sBfRtghoWQxsDbSko4Xniimc